ESSAYS SELECTED AND TRANSLATED BY STEPHEN HEATH

'Image-Music-Text' brings together major essays by Roland Barthes on the structural analysis of narrative and on issues in literary theory, on the semiotics of photograph and film, on the practice of music and voice.

Throughout the volume runs a constant movement 'from work to text': an attention to the very ‘grain’ of signifying activity and the desire to follow – in literature, image, film, song and theatre – whatever turns, displaces, shifts, disperses.

Stephen Heath, whose translation has been described as “skilful and readable” (TLS) and “quite brilliant” (TES), is the author of 'Vertige du déplacement', a study of Barthes. His selection of essays, each important in its own right, also serves as “the best…introduction so far to Barthes’ career as the slayer of contemporary myths” (JOHN STURROCK, 'New Statesman).'

This book is a translation of selected texts written by Roland Barthes and originally published in French between 1961 and 1971 in various French-speaking magazines and journals.

As the title of the book suggests, these texts deal with various topics related to issues dealing with image, music and text.

It will be of various interest to various readers, very much in the same way as another famous collection of articles written by Barthes such as Mythologies (Vintage Classics).
